Что такое ASIO4ALL?
ASIO4ALL — это бесплатный универсальный аудиодрайвер для операционной системы Windows, который эмулирует протокол ASIO (Audio Stream Input/Output) для звуковых устройств, изначально его не поддерживающих. Если говорить простыми словами, это программа-«переводчик», которая позволяет профессиональным музыкальным приложениям (DAW — цифровые аудио рабочие станции, таким как FL Studio, Ableton Live, Cubase и другим) эффективно работать практически с любой звуковой картой или чипом, включая встроенные в материнскую плату (Realtek, Conexant и т.д.).
Основная цель ASIO4ALL — радикально уменьшить задержку (латентность) при вводе и выводе аудиосигнала. Высокая задержка — главная проблема стандартных драйверов Windows (DirectSound, MME), которая делает невозможной комфортную запись «вживую» или игру на MIDI-клавиатуре, когда звук воспроизводится с заметной задержкой после нажатия клавиши.
ASIO4ALL не является драйвером в классическом понимании. Это драйвер-обёртка (WDM wrapper), который использует стандартные возможности Windows, но организует работу с аудио более эффективно, минуя лишние слои системной обработки.
Для чего нужен ASIO4ALL?
Программа необходима в первую очередь музыкантам, звукорежиссёрам и всем, кто занимается созданием музыки на ПК. Вот ключевые задачи, которые она решает:
- Минимизация задержки аудио (Latency). Позволяет снизить задержку до значений в несколько миллисекунд (часто 5-20 мс), что делает запись и живую обработку звука реальной.
- Работа с профессиональным софтом без специализированной звуковой карты. Многие DAW по умолчанию требуют для работы драйвер ASIO. ASIO4ALL даёт возможность запустить такой софт на обычном компьютере.
- Прямой мониторинг. Позволяет слышать звук с микрофона или инструмента в реальном времени с наложенными эффектами (например, гитарными процессорами), что критически важно для записи.
- Использование многоканального ввода/вывода. Даёт доступ ко всем доступным входам и выходам звукового устройства, даже если стандартные драйверы Windows их «скрывают».
Как работает ASIO4ALL?
Принцип работы основан на обходе многокомпонентной аудиоподсистемы Windows, которая добавляет существенную задержку для обеспечения универсальности и совместимости. ASIO4ALL устанавливает прямое взаимодействие между аудиоприложением и аппаратным обеспечением звуковой карты на низком уровне.
После установки и настройки программа создаёт виртуальное ASIO-устройство, которое отображается во всех поддерживающих этот стандарт программах. Пользователь выбирает это устройство в настройках аудио своей DAW и получает доступ к тонкой настройке буферов, что напрямую влияет на задержку.
Ограничения и недостатки
Несмотря на популярность, ASIO4ALL — это компромиссное решение. Его главные минусы:
- Нестабильность с некоторым оборудованием. Поскольку это универсальный драйвер, он может конфликтовать с конкретными моделями звуковых чипов, вызывать щелчки, хрипы или обрывы звука (артефакты).
- Блокировка звукового устройства. Когда ASIO4ALL используется программой, он часто монопольно захватывает звуковую карту, и другие приложения (браузер, плеер) не могут воспроизводить звук.
- Меньшая эффективность по сравнению с «родными» ASIO-драйверами. Для профессиональных внешних аудиоинтерфейсов всегда рекомендуется использовать фирменные драйверы от производителя, которые обеспечивают максимальную стабильность и минимальную задержку.
Установка и базовая настройка
Установка программы очень проста: нужно скачать установщик с официального сайта и следовать инструкциям. После установки драйвер не появляется как отдельная программа в меню «Пуск». Настройка производится через панель управления, которая открывается изнутри поддерживающего ASIO софта (например, из настроек FL Studio).
Ключевой параметр настройки — размер буфера (Buffer Size), измеряемый в сэмплах. Чем меньше буфер, тем меньше задержка, но выше нагрузка на процессор и риск появления артефактов. Чем больше буфер — задержка растёт, но стабильность повышается. Оптимальное значение подбирается экспериментально для конкретного компьютера и проекта.
Альтернативы ASIO4ALL
Для пользователей Windows, серьезно занимающихся музыкой, существуют более продвинутые варианты:
- Фирменные ASIO-драйверы от производителя аудиоинтерфейса (Focusrite, Behringer, Presonus и др.) — лучшее решение.
- Драйвер FlexASIO — современная open-source альтернатива с более гибкими настройками.
- Протокол WASAPI в режиме Exclusive, встроенный в Windows Vista и новее. Он также обеспечивает низкую задержку и прямую работу с устройством, поддерживается некоторыми DAW.
Таким образом, ASIO4ALL — это важный инструмент в мире компьютерной музыки, который много лет позволяет начинающим музыкантам и энтузиастам преодолеть технические ограничения «домашнего» железа и погрузиться в мир звукозаписи и производства. Однако для профессиональной работы рекомендуется переход на специализированную звуковую карту (аудиоинтерфейс) с её родными оптимизированными драйверами.
Комментарии
—Войдите, чтобы оставить комментарий